SOUTHERN BLOT


Meaning of SOUTHERN BLOT in English

Biol., Med.

a procedure for identifying and measuring the amount of a specific DNA sequence or gene in a mixed extract, as in testing for a mutation or a virus: DNA strands from the person or organism under study are cut with restriction enzymes, separated by gel electrophoresis, transferred to special filter paper, and hybridized with a labeled DNA probe.

[ after Edwin M. Southern, originator of the technique ]
